Flights Which destinations planes fly to from each airport has helped determine their personalities. Tenerife South has flights to around destinations whereas planes from Tenerife North only fly to 21 locations this can change with different seasons.

Flights from Tenerife South connect the island with various destinations around Europe, including main British airports. Basically where most holidaymakers fly in from. There are some flights to Spanish destinations and other Canary Islands, but not many. Flights from Tenerife North are mostly to Spanish cities and most flights to other Canary Islands are from the north airport.

Personality Two factors have a noticeable impact on the personality of north and south airports; flight routes and location. One airport mainly serves the southern resorts and the other mainly serves the Canarian population and mainland Spanish holidaymakers. Subsequently Tenerife South feels like the holiday airport it is and Tenerife North has more of a business airport vibe.

Whereas most flights from Tenerife South are filled with holidaymakers, flights from Tenerife North to other islands are basically commuter travel with seats being filled mostly by business people and politicians.

Having a multitude of connections to different parts of the world, the South Airport is the busiest.

Meanwhile, the North Airport operates mostly domestic flights between the islands of the archipelago. Located in the historic town of San Cristobal de la Laguna , the airport essentially links Tenerife to the other islands of the archipelago as well as some international destinations. From its opening to air traffic in , the airport has made tremendous strides in improving the level and quality of its service. Runways were stretched, new navigation aids were installed and more aircraft parking spaces were provided.
